Queen Hildegarde (Summarized Edition)
Queen Hildegarde introduces a pampered city girl exiled to a plain New England farm, where she trades borrowed "royalty" for the nobility of work, loyalty, and neighborly duty. Richards's brisk, companionable prose blends comic episodes with keen observation of domestic labor, its gentle didacticism characteristic of late-nineteenth-century girls' fiction. Episodic chapters form a moral apprenticeship, while local-color detail-kitchen garden, quilting, village calls-grounds the conversion narrative.
In the Alcottian tradition, 'queenship' becomes character rather than pedigree. Laura Elizabeth Howe Richards, daughter of reformers Julia Ward Howe and Samuel Gridley Howe, wrote from a household steeped in service and letters. Living in Maine, she produced lively juvenile fiction and verse, and later won a Pulitzer for coauthoring her mother's biography. Her conviction that cheerful industry and community obligation refine the self animates Hildegarde's arc; the rural setting distills rhythms she knew and respected.
